Seared Salmon Fillet with Garlic Green Beans and Brown Rice

Enjoy a delightful dinner featuring a perfectly seared salmon fillet served alongside garlicky green beans and a hearty portion of brown rice. This balanced dish is crafted with simple, clean ingredients and a drizzle of olive oil to bring all the flavors together, ensuring a satisfying meal that meets your nutritional goals.

NUTRITION

872kcal
Protein
49.1g
Fat
41.8g
Carbs
78g

SERVINGS

1 serving

INGREDIENTS

7 oz Salmon Fillet

1.5 cups cooked Brown Rice

1 cup Green Beans

1.5 tbsp Olive Oil

2 cloves Garlic

Salt and Pepper to taste

PREPARATION

  • 1

    Rinse the salmon fillet and pat dry with paper towels. Season lightly with salt and pepper.

  • 2

    Heat a non-stick skillet over medium-high heat and add 1 tablespoon of olive oil.

  • 3

    Place the salmon skin-side down (if applicable) and sear for about 4 minutes on each side until a golden crust forms and the salmon is nearly cooked through. Remove from the pan and cover loosely with foil.

  • 4

    In the same skillet, add the remaining 0.5 tablespoon of olive oil along with the minced garlic. Sauté for about 30 seconds until fragrant.

  • 5

    Add the green beans to the skillet and toss them in the garlic oil. Cook for about 4-5 minutes until they are tender-crisp, stirring occasionally.

  • 6

    While the green beans are cooking, prepare the brown rice if not already done. Warm it up if needed.

  • 7

    Plate the dish by placing a bed of brown rice, laying the seared salmon atop the rice, and arranging the garlic green beans on the side.

  • 8

    Finish with an optional sprinkle of salt and pepper to taste, and serve immediately.
